Output bdf3538d009bc44c072ea1f86b7b3f4c4aeddfb34769bfbbfaa897de3fef6fb5:1

value
76665
script pubkey
OP_0 OP_PUSHBYTES_20 8b9e24a417e3db51e5e5818f20578eb853047f0b
address
bc1q3w0zffqhu0d4re09sx8jq4uwhpfsglctqz6un7
transaction
bdf3538d009bc44c072ea1f86b7b3f4c4aeddfb34769bfbbfaa897de3fef6fb5
confirmations
27489
spent
true